Commonwealth summit to start in Samoa

Though the Commonwealth summit has been branded a talkfest, it’ll deal with networking and alliance constructing over concrete insurance policies – regardless of Pacific nations prone to local weather change persevering with to push leaders to part out fossil fuels.

As AAP stories, the conferences “aren’t transformational” however the Pacific can be trying to construct on connections to different areas and draw consideration to the existential risk of rising sea ranges, Pacific professional Meg Eager mentioned.

That’s not trivial, there’s 56 international locations – a few third of the world’s inhabitants – there are usually not solely leaders, there are key choice makers and, after all, there’s media.

Pacific nations can be trying to increase issues earlier than the COP surroundings convention in November and collect help for an Worldwide Courtroom of Justice case on obligations states relating to local weather change, she mentioned.

Prof Jioji Ravulo, who specialises in Pacific communities, additionally framed local weather as the principle challenge however mentioned it was necessary Australia used its diplomatic clout to elevation regional voices. Problems with gender equality, poverty and financial improvement “all come back to a common denominator, which is climate change”, he mentioned.

Anthony Albanese mentioned Australia “values the significant role Samoa plays in our region and the close partnership between our two countries” as he makes his first journey to the Pacific nation as chief.

Whereas Canberra had a pivotal position in these conversations as a significant regional voice, it mustn’t use its weight to impose on Pacific companions and solely function “within the terms of what Australia wants”, Ravulo mentioned.

“It’s not a shared relationship, it’s one where Australia continues to create expectations,” he mentioned, pointing to stories an NRL crew settlement with Papua New Guinea would preclude Chinese language safety forces within the Pacific nation.

Samoan chief Fiamē Naomi Mata’afa is looking for an ocean declaration that will deal with governance of the seas and the impacts rising sea ranges and temperatures have on coastal communities and livelihoods, Eager mentioned.

Poorer nations can be in search of bigger companions to assist economically and Australia is the first maritime accomplice for a lot of the area, she mentioned.

Kids in a position to report nude pictures despatched through iMessage to Apple, which may report back to police

Kids will be capable to report nude pictures and video being despatched to them through iMessage direct to Apple, which may then report the matter to police, underneath modifications coming to iOS in Australia.

As a part of the beta releases for iOS and iPadOS 18.2 and MacOS 15.2 for Australian customers launched at the moment, customers will now have the flexibility to report pictures or video containing nudity to Apple. It’s an extension of its present communications security options that since iOS 17 have been turned on by default for Apple customers underneath 13, however can be found to all customers.

Underneath the modifications, when a warning a few nude picture comes up, customers may even have the choice to report back to Apple.

The machine will put together a report containing the photographs or movies, in addition to messages despatched instantly earlier than and after the picture or video. It would embrace the contact data from each accounts, and customers can fill out a type describing what occurred.

The report can be reviewed by Apple, which may take motion on an account – comparable to disabling that person’s means to ship messages over iMessage – and in addition report the difficulty to legislation enforcement.

The timing of the announcement in addition to selecting Australia as the primary to get the brand new function coincides with new codes coming into drive in Australia by the top of 2024 forcing tech corporations to detect little one abuse and terror content material on cloud and messaging providers.

Might overseas leaders actually be delay from visiting Australia due to Lidia Thorpe’s verbal assault on the king? Liberal senators assume so and have instructed imposing penalties for overstepping the mark. The opposition Senate chief has flagged the opportunity of new penalties for senators who have interaction in “disorderly conduct” past the chamber itself, after unbiased senator Lidia Thorpe’s shouted protest at a parliamentary reception for King Charles III and Queen Camilla.

Abortion continues to be a key challenge within the Queensland election with the Greens promising at the moment to introduce a invoice banning the state authorities from any new offers to outsource public hospitals to organisations that refuse to supply abortions. Guardian Australia reported final 12 months on issues that Catholic-run public hospitals wouldn’t present reproductive care. The Greens’ transfer comes after senior Coalition ladies rejected Jacinta Nampijinpa Value’s feedback about abortion, saying the Liberal occasion had “no interest in unwinding women’s reproductive rights” and saying it was a problem superior by “fringe” politicians.

Commonwealth leaders will meet in Samoa from at the moment with the surroundings, ocean well being and financial improvement on the playing cards – however the UK prime minister, Keir Starmer, says he doesn’t need to have “endless discussions” about reparations. Anthony Albanese can be attending the Commonwealth heads of presidency assembly (Chogm) together with King Charles and different leaders from the group of former British colonies.
